"The allegations, if true, are deeply disturbing and disappointing. Everytime you get this, you need to deal with it decisively and firmly...inevitably (because of) human nature, you will have people who succumb to temptation...whether in the Civil Service, banks, law firms (or) institutions. Despite having best controls...somebody will try to beat it.What we need to do is always to be vigilant...and to make sure that these are exceptions and they don't become the norm."

- Mr K Shanmmugam, Minister for Law and Minister for Foreign Affairs
